Package akka.http.javadsl.model
Class RemoteAddress
- java.lang.Object
-
- akka.http.javadsl.model.RemoteAddress
-
- Direct Known Subclasses:
RemoteAddress
public abstract class RemoteAddress ext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description RemoteAddress()
-
Method Summary
All Methods Static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description static RemoteAddresscreate(byte[] address)static RemoteAddresscreate(java.net.InetAddress address)static RemoteAddresscreate(java.net.InetSocketAddress address)abstract java.util.Optional<java.net.InetAddress>getAddress()abstract intgetPort()Returns a port if defined or 0 otherwise.abstract booleanisUnknown()
-
-
-
Method Detail
-
isUnknown
public abstract boolean isUnknown()
-
getAddress
public abstract java.util.Optional<java.net.InetAddress> getAddress()
-
getPort
public abstract int getPort()
Returns a port if defined or 0 otherwise.
-
create
public static RemoteAddress create(java.net.InetAddress address)
-
create
public static RemoteAddress create(java.net.InetSocketAddress address)
-
create
public static RemoteAddress create(byte[] address)
-
-